Chapter 124 Drama
- Angel’s eyelids fluttered open slowly, her head throbbing with a dull, relentless ache. The sterile smell of antiseptic and the faint beeping of machines brought her back to reality. Blinking against the bright lights overhead, she tried to piece together where she was and how she had ended up here.
- Her gaze shifted to the large television mounted on the wall, where a news anchor was speaking in urgent tones. The screen was split, with her photograph on one side and a live shot of Amanda and Nonna on the other. Amanda was crying, her face pale and drawn as she pleaded with the viewers.
- “Please, if anyone knows where she is, help us,” Amanda said, her voice cracking. “She’s been missing for two days, and we’re so worried about her.”
